Patient Specific Jigs/Instruments
Uses data from CT/ MRI/ X-rays
Planning is carried out in the preoperative stage
Surgeons and Engineers formulate a plan
Jigs are 3D printed and Shipped

Current Limitations
No intraoperative measure to test the accuracy
Accuracy depends on the images/ Operators
Issues with the materials used for making these Jigs
Deals with all the deformities as static
![Page 16: Limitations & future of 3 d printing in orthopedics](https://reader036.vdocuments.pub/reader036/viewer/2022062820/58a478d31a28aba34c8b6717/html5/thumbnails/16.jpg)
The Future
Intraoperative integertaion with realtime navigation systems
Expansion to different areas beyond TKR/ Osteotomies and Resurfacing
Tactile feedback incorporation into the instrumentation systems

Limitations
Still grappling with accuracy to match mass production
Material issues
Turn around time
Cost issues
Operator dependant
![Page 22: Limitations & future of 3 d printing in orthopedics](https://reader036.vdocuments.pub/reader036/viewer/2022062820/58a478d31a28aba34c8b6717/html5/thumbnails/22.jpg)
The Future
Newer Biocompatible materials: HA TCP printing/ Biopolymers
Faster turn around
Manufacture anywhere even in the OT
Get exactly what you and your patient require/ wish

In vitro..
Regenerating Cartilage , Bones & Scaffolds
Use natural polymers: Collagen/HA/Silk Proteins/Alginate
Coupled with hydrogels - PGA/ PCL/Methacrylate
Cross linked chemically, thermally or using UV
Sprayed with hMSCs
